Cognizant

Cognizant Accelerates AI Push with New India Lab and Strategic Acquisition Amid Strong Q3 Momentum.

  • Q3 revenue hit $5.42B, up 7.4% YoY and beating estimates by $100M, driven by broad-based growth and six large deals that underscore robust IT services demand.
  • Adjusted EPS rose 11% to $1.39, topping forecasts, with management lifting full-year revenue guidance to 6.0%-6.3% constant currency, reflecting AI-fueled confidence.
  • Pending Q1 2026 close of 3Cloud deal bolsters Azure and AI capabilities, while insider sales remain minor against $1.5B year-to-date shareholder returns.

Tencent Music

Tencent Music Powers Ahead with 27% Revenue Surge on SVIP Boom and Live Concert Frenzy

  • Music subscriptions climbed 17% to RMB4.5B, propelled by elevated ARPPU and SVIP users topping 15 million, underscoring sticky premium demand.
  • Live operations soared with 14 sold-out G-DRAGON concerts across Asia and the debut TMElive International Music Awards, diversifying revenue beyond streaming.
  • Fresh deals with Korean and Japanese labels boosted content ecosystem, enhancing platform stickiness and positioning TME for global music dominance.

Pros

  • Cognizant maintains a diversified service portfolio across financial services, health sciences, and digital engineering, reducing reliance on any single industry.
  • The company has demonstrated consistent profitability, with a trailing twelve-month net income exceeding $2 billion and a reasonable forward price-to-earnings ratio.
  • Cognizant offers a dividend yield, providing income alongside potential capital appreciation for investors seeking total return.

Considerations

  • Revenue growth has been modest recently, with the company facing intensifying competition in global IT services and digital transformation markets.
  • Cognizant’s valuation, while not excessive, does not appear deeply discounted relative to historical levels or sector peers.
  • The business is exposed to macroeconomic sensitivity, particularly in client discretionary spending on technology and consulting during downturns.

Pros

  • Tencent Music benefits from dominant market share in China’s online music industry, backed by the expansive Tencent ecosystem and strong user engagement.
  • The company has delivered solid profitability metrics, including a healthy return on equity and robust interest coverage, indicating financial resilience.
  • Tencent Music has scalable platforms for music streaming, social entertainment, and copyright monetisation, supporting recurring revenue streams.

Considerations

  • Valuation multiples such as price-to-earnings and price-to-sales are elevated compared to global peers, potentially limiting near-term upside.
  • Regulatory scrutiny in China’s technology and entertainment sectors could impose unexpected constraints on operations or growth initiatives.
  • User growth in core music services may slow as the market matures, increasing reliance on monetisation of existing users and new product innovations.
